Mountains to the Sea

Past Event: 18 October 2004 to 7 November 2004

Illustrating the concept of water catchment.

Mountains to the Sea is part-diorama and part-sculpture. The display comprises more than 300 pieces, over half of which are moving.

Developed by the West Gippsland Catchment Management Authority and artist Col Suggett.
